Casting Time: 1 action
Range: 60 feet
Components: V, S, M (a bit of tallow, a pinch of brimstone, and a dusting of powdered iron)
Duration: Concentration, up to 1 minute
A 5-foot-diameter sphere of fire appears in an unoccupied space of
your choice within range and lasts for the duration. Any creature that
ends its turn within 5 feet of the sphere must make a Dexterity saving
throw. The creature takes 2d6 fire damage on a failed save, or half as
much damage on a successful one.
As a bonus action, you can move the sphere up to 30 feet. If you ram the
sphere into a creature, that creature must make the saving throw
against the sphere's damage, and the sphere stops moving this turn.
When you move the sphere, you can direct it over barriers up to 5 feet
tall and jump it across pits up to 10 feet wide. The sphere ignites
flammable objects not being worn or carried, and it sheds bright light
in a 20-foot radius and dim light for an additional 20 feet.
At Higher Levels. When you cast this spell using a spell slot of 3rd level or higher, the damage increases by 1d6 for each slot level above 2nd.
